ERIE, Pa. – The Penn State Behrend women's bowling team finished third out of six teams on the final day of their annual Grapevine Classic held at Eastland Bowl on Sunday.
Baker Scores:
Penn State Behrend 788, Hilbert 730
Penn State Behrend 774, Pitt-Bradford 739
St. Vincent 943, Penn State Behrend 923
Penn State Behrend 928, D'Youville 878
St. Vincent 946, Penn State Behrend 850
Key Moments:
* After nine rounds, the Lions were in second place by 90 points
* Behrend collected back-to-back wins, defeating Hilbert and Pitt-Bradford
* The Lions fell twice to St. Vincent and tallied a 928-878 win over D'Youville to finish 3-2 on the day
* In the first match against the Bearcats, Behrend won four of the five games but St. Vincent won in total points
* In the 10th game, the position round, Daemen defeated D'Youville by 96 points to bump the Lions into third place
* Behrend was six points shy of second place
* The Lions bowled their best baker game of 237 against the Bearcats
* For the weekend, Behrend totaled 8,685 pins and a 173.7 average
* Lillie Holt was named to the All-Tournament Team
